Quarantot
Birrificio Lambrate in Milan/Milano (MI), Lombardy, Italy 🇮🇹
IPA - Imperial / Double Regular|
Score
7.04
|
|
Our Quarantot Double IPA is characterised by the extravagant use of various types of American hops to create a complex taste and aromatic experience on a base of Pilsner and Pale malts. Fermentation with a strain of American yeast triggers an explosion of hoppy aromas, bringing out their fruity notes.

(Keg at Koht, 20170722) The beer poured golden and hazy. Its head was medium sized and white. Aroma had fruitiness, citricness and malts. Palate was medium bodied with medium carbonation. Flavours were fruitiness, citricness, sweetness, malts and bitterness. Aftertaste was hoppy, fruity and bitter. A nice fruity strong brew.

From the tap at FOB, Rimini, Italy. Pours pale gold with white foam. Aroma is resinous, with also fruity feelings. Also some herbaceous. Body is medium-dense. Taste is rather bitter, with a good body to support it, though the bitterness is long lasting in the finish.
